摘要

Emboli originating from the left atrial appendage are a major cause of transient ischemic attack and cardioembolic stroke. Whereas this risk has been shown to be correlated with left atrial appendage morphology (Cactus, Chicken Wing, Windsock, and Cauliflower shapes) determined from 3D imaging, this clinical correlation is found wanting with regard to a biomechanically grounded underlying basis for thrombosis based on intra-atrial hemodynamics. We define a novel probabilistic risk stratification paradigm for intra-atrial flow stasis based on personalized computational fluid dynamics.
